Texas-inspired dog names inspired by great musicians:

If you’re a music lover and want to find a Texas-inspired dog name for your loyal companion, why not consider the names of some great musicians who hail from the Lone Star State? Here are a few suggestions:

1. Willie: Pay homage to the legendary Willie Nelson, a Texas-born country music singer and songwriter.

2. Stevie: This name is perfect for fans of Stevie Ray Vaughan, the influential blues guitarist from Texas.

3. Selena: Named after the beloved Tejano singer Selena Quintanilla, who was born in Lake Jackson, Texas.

4. Buddy: Inspired by Buddy Holly, the rock and roll pioneer who was born in Lubbock, Texas.

5. Janis: Honor the memory of Janis Joplin, the iconic singer from Port Arthur, Texas.

6. George: A classic name inspired by George Strait, the “King of Country” who was born in Poteet, Texas.

7. Beyoncé: For fans of the Houston-born superstar Beyoncé Knowles, who needs no introduction.

8. Townes: This unique name is a nod to the influential singer-songwriter Townes Van Zandt, who was born in Fort Worth, Texas.

9. T-Bone: Inspired by T-Bone Walker, a Texas blues guitarist and singer known for his influential style.

10. Lyle: Pay tribute to Lyle Lovett, the Grammy-winning singer-songwriter from Klein, Texas.
